QUOTE(praveena.k12 @ Oct 12 2009, 05:16 PM)
Tune Talk really really sucks. Its the worst telco ever. I bought the sim pack then found out my callers had to listen to ads before they can connect to me. So stupid. I straight ported out from Tune Talk to Digi. It took about 8 hours. At first after porting, both sim cards are still active. But after one day, the Tune Talk sim is deactivated and only the Digi sim is active. When you are porting out, you must tell Digi you are porting out from Celcom. Some Customer Service ppl at the Digi Specialised store don't know that Tune Talk is from Celcom so they will say no cannot port. But just say its from Celcom and you can port out within a day. I think everyone is just getting all the nice numbers and porting straight. I sent a complaint email and they just said "The ads are part of Tune Talk" but it doesn't say any where in the T & C that you callers have to first listen to 10 seconds of annoying ads before they can connect to your number. Tune Talk is definitely going to lose customers like this!
